What does the The Voice winner get?
Mainly two prizes. The first is a recording contract from Universal Music Group, while the second is a cash reward. Reports say the total is $100,000.
Chevel Shepherd, who won season 15 at the age of 16, previously told the outlet that she had little idea how she would spend the money.
“Maybe a car,” she added. “We had to postpone getting my license because of The Voice, so when we get back [home]I have to get it.
She continued, “I would love to have a Chevelle because that’s my name. So my dad and I are probably going to buy one and build a ’72. [Chevrolet] Chevelle together.”
